Romans 1:14-16
English Standard Version
14 (A)I am under obligation both to Greeks and to (B)barbarians,[a] both to the wise and to the foolish. 15 So I am eager to preach the gospel to you also who are in Rome.
The Righteous Shall Live by Faith
16 For (C)I am not ashamed of the gospel, for it is (D)the power of God for salvation to everyone who believes, to the Jew (E)first and also to (F)the Greek.

Romans 1:14-16
New International Version
14 I am obligated(A) both to Greeks and non-Greeks, both to the wise and the foolish. 15 That is why I am so eager to preach the gospel also to you who are in Rome.(B)
16 For I am not ashamed of the gospel,(C) because it is the power of God(D) that brings salvation to everyone who believes:(E) first to the Jew,(F) then to the Gentile.(G)
